Best time to go to Somerset

Somerset has a varied climate due to its size, so the best time to visit depends on the region and your preferences for weather and crowds. June to August are the peak travel months in Somerset,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is sunny, accompanied by no rainfall. On the other hand, January, February, and April t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by no to light rainfall and sunny conditions.

When Is the Best Time to Visit Glendale?

  • Hottest months: August, July, September, June (average 74°F)
  • Coldest months: February, December, January, March (average 55°F)
  • Rainiest months: December, January, March, February (average 3 inches of rainfall)
